Parking and shuttles were great. We were able to get our coupons for the beer. While the food trucks were great, it would have been nice to have popcorn or something else besides heavy food. Definitely loved that BaconMania was there! I agree with others in that I could not see any difference between the VIP ticket prices and general admission. We loved the band Supercilious and hope to see them again. They had the crowd singing along with them. The event was sold out! We will definitely be back again next year.

Rather than having the event on Sutter Street it was held in the parking lot below - so basically the event was in a parking lot with no seating or ability to stop at restaurants or bars along the way.
